Job Description

We have an opening for an ElectroOptical Diagnostic Engineer in the Target Diagnostic Engineering & Science (TDES) Group for the National Ignition Facility. You will be responsible for the engineering and experimental setup of various target diagnostic systems.  You will provide engineering support for new additions upgrades to existing hardware overall coordination implementation of shot setup maintenance and repair for a set of optical diagnostic systems.  Your work will involve project management and navigation of NIFspecific business applications. This position is in the Laser Systems Engineering & Operations (LSEO) Division of the Engineering Directorate.

This position will be filled at either the SES.1 or SES.2 level depending on your qualifications. Additional job responsibilities (outlined below) will be assigned if you are selected at the higher level.

 In this role you will

  • Interact within the organization and act as a common point of contact for optical xray or nuclear diagnostics to ensure they are designed set up and operate effectively in a 24/7 facility.
  • Contribute to the system design implementation and integration for system components.
  • Address experimental concerns for newly designed hardware such as: location interference with other Target Area activities considerations for facility or utility impacts installation plans and staffing/operational plans.
  • Maintain test and upgrade operational diagnostic systems evaluating readily identifiable factors and using standard techniques and methodologies.
  • Participate and collaborate with and contribute to engineering support of operations by providing solutions for preventative maintenance engineering documentation and process improvements while adhering to defined practices and procedures.
  • Resolve disposition track and provide solutions to operational problems of limited complexity associated with any of the assigned systems employed on NIF and promote design changes.
  • Ensure offline calibration and availability of critical spare system components.
  • Perform other duties as assigned.

Qualifications :

  • Ability to obtain and maintain a U.S. DOE Qlevel security clearance which requires U.S. citizenship.
  • Bachelors degree in Optical Engineering Engineering Physics Electrical Engineering or related field or the equivalent combination of education and related experience.
  • Fundamental knowledge of optical xray or nuclear recording techniques as well as optical or electrical design fabrication installation and testing of components.
  • Operational experience with oscilloscopes power supplies delay generators power meters and timedomain reflectometers.
  • Sufficient verbal and written communication skills to collaborate effectively in a team environment and present and explain technical information.
  • Experience using fundamental project management practices.
  • Ability to work in confined or restricted movement areas climb stairs stand or walk for long periods of time and pass NIF Radiological Worker I qualification.
